How To See Your Likes On Facebook is a process that allows you to view all of the posts, pages, and other content that you have liked on Facebook. This can be a useful way to find old content that you may have forgotten about, or to see what you have liked in the past. Additionally, it can be a good way to manage your likes and unlike any content that you no longer find interesting.

To see your likes on Facebook, simply click on the “Likes” tab on your profile page. This will show you a list of all of the content that you have liked, organized by date. You can then scroll through the list and click on any item to view it.

Question 1: How can I see my likes on Facebook?

Answer: To see your likes on Facebook, simply click on the “Likes” tab on your profile page. This will show you a list of all of the content that you have liked, organized by date.

Question 2: Can I see all of the likes that I have ever made on Facebook?

Answer: Yes, you can see all of the likes that you have ever made on Facebook, as long as they are still available on the platform. However, if a post or page that you liked has been deleted, you will not be able to see it in your likes list.

Question 3: Can I unlike content on Facebook?

Answer: Yes, you can unlike content on Facebook at any time. To unlike a post or page, simply hover over the like button and click on the “Unlike” option.

Question 4: Can I share my likes with others?

Answer: Yes, you can share your likes with others on Facebook. To share a like, simply click on the share button below the post or page that you want to share.

Tips for Managing Your Likes on Facebook

Here are a few tips for managing your likes on Facebook:

Tip 1: Regularly review your likes.

Take some time each month to review your likes and unlike any content that you no longer find interesting or relevant. This will help to keep your feed clutter-free and full of content that you enjoy.

Tip 2: Use the “Hide” option.

If you don’t want to unlike a post but you don’t want to see it in your feed anymore, you can use the “Hide” option. This will remove the post from your feed without unliking it.

Tip 3: Create custom lists.

Facebook allows you to create custom lists of friends and family members. You can use these lists to control who can see your likes. For example, you can create a list of close friends and family and only share your likes with them.

Tip 4: Use privacy settings.

Facebook’s privacy settings allow you to control who can see your likes. You can choose to make your likes public, visible to friends only, or visible to only you.
